WILLMAR -- The River Lakes Stars busted out of a seven-game slump in style by stunning Willmar 3-1 at the Cardinals' own tournament on Thursday evening at the Civic Center.
Blake Williamson, Josh Engquist and Reggie Fraley scored goals for the Stars, who hadn't won since a 4-3 victory over Prairie Centre on Nov. 28. Alex Naujokos assisted on all three goals.
The Stars, who come mainly from Rocori, Paynesville and New London-Spicer, have now won three straight over Willmar.
Willmar outshot the Stars 35-25, but didn't solve River Lakes' goalie Brian Skluzacek until a power-play goal by Griffin Leitch 5:13 into the last frame.
That made it 3-1.

The Stars beat Willmar twice last year 5-1 and 3-0.
In the early game, Prairie Centre (4-6) put 69 shots on Redwood Valley goalie Matt Hanson and defeated the Cardinals (0-8) by a 7-1 score.
Eight penalties were whistle on Willmar and 10 on River Lakes.
Enquist's power-play goal 19 seconds into the third period gave the Stars a 2-0 lead. Willmar rained 14 shots on Skluzacek in the third period.
The tournament continues today with River Lakes and Redwood Valley at 6 p.m. and Prairie Centre and Willmar following at about 8:15 p.m.
Note: The 13 goals scored by Willmar on Wednesday versus the fledgling Redwood Valley program were the most since the third game of 1983 season, a 16-0 romp against Buffalo.
